Ejemplo n.º 1
0
 public void Should_create_a_non_target_proxy_using_a_generic_type_and_an_interceptor()
 {
     var interceptor = new ReturnValueInterceptor("ack");
     var factory = new ProxyFactory(AppConfig.ProxyBehavior);
     var proxy = factory.Create<Goo>(interceptor);
     Assert.Equal("ack", proxy.Go());
 }
Ejemplo n.º 2
0
        public void Should_create_a_non_target_proxy_using_a_generic_type_and_an_interceptor()
        {
            var interceptor = new ReturnValueInterceptor("ack");
            var factory     = new ProxyFactory(AppConfig.ProxyBehavior);
            var proxy       = factory.Create <IFoo>(interceptor);

            Assert.Equal("ack", proxy.Go());
        }